Added to the Code in 2005, the means test is intended to screen out those filing Chapter 7 who are supposedly able to repay some part of their debts. The test is found in Official Form B22a. Debtors who fail the means test may convert their case to another chapter of bankruptcy. More about how the means test works. (Bankruptcy in Brief)

A method for projecting surplus income of a consumer Chapter 7 debtor. Under this test, if a Chapter 7 debtor's income exceeds allowed expenses by a certain minimum amount per month, the debtor's Chapter 7 will be dismissed, leaving Chapter 13 as his only bankruptcy alternative. (Bernstein's Dictionary of Bankruptcy Terminology)
